I took my 2006 jeep to Redlich because I was told I had a problem with my transmission.The person at Redlich,I think his name was Tim told me I needed a new transmission.He could not tell me what was wrong with my transmission ,but did tell me the new one would cost $2,500. I said no thanks and left with my vehicle.On the way home I stopped at another transmission shop. I told them the problem and they put it on the rack and within 10 minutes they told me there was no problem with the transmission.All I needed was a new drive shaft...a $250 part! With tax and labor, it cost me all of $307.70. Thank God for Mikes Transmissions,and SHAME ON REDLICH! I just worry about the seniors who might not know any better.

I thought there was a mjaro problem with my transmission - 2 other shops and a dealer told me that I needed a new one. I took my car to Gillece on Rt 51 and after testing and road testing they fixed a solenoid body and I was on my way. I was upset because they had my car for 2 days before I knew the exact problem, although the other shops also had it for 2 or so days, but I am glad they took their time and found the correct fix or I would have replaced a whole transmission instead of just the parts it needed.

I took my vehicle to this location for a transmission and engine code diagnostics. They took the vehicle out for a 5 minute drive and reported that the transmission was "toast" and that both catalytic converters were bad. They recommended a used transmission, converters, and O2 sensors. The repairs were made, bad on me I should have checked the price they were asking for the used transmission which was as much as a NEW transmission. The following week the transmission started acting up again so I looked at the invoice a little closer, they listed the wrong transmission being put in, so I went underneath to look at it and found what appeared to be my old transmission, I stripped a bolt hole when I did the fluid change and they had a shiny new bolt in the same hole that I put the old one back in. Called to explain what happened and Larry basically called me a liar and told me to bring it back in and they would "make it right." By this time I noticed what sounded like a small exhaust leak starting, and decided I would look into it after the weather got nicer. Another used transmission that took twice as long as the "first" one. Fast forward a couple weeks and the small exhaust leak is now a rumbling roar and it's 7 degrees outside with 6 inches of snow on the ground. The snow finally melts and I crawl under again and find that the clamp they reused had completely let go and my exhaust is completely open, my resonator and muffler are full of water, and my tailpipe has busted off the muffler. What I assume happened is the pipes came apart and as I drove the truck kicked snow and water up into the gaping hole in my exhaust, then froze at the end and broke the weld holding the tailpipe on. I call them AGAIN to ask for rework and I am told that they have a reputation of doing excellent work and that the only reason they "keep striking out with me is because I am a mechanic and can find fault in anything" and that "the exhaust clamp was probably bad." Me being a mechanic has no bearing at all on not doing a proper job. Moving on to the follow-up repair, they pulled my truck in and Larry proceeded to come out and tell me that there was no water in my muffler and that its not their fault that they used a bad clamp on rotten exhaust, with out saying a word about it to me, and that I would have to pay them to fix it. Sprinkled through this tirade were several offers of physical violence, finally resulting in Larry flat out telling me to leave or he would kick my ass as he walked through the door and locked it. My truck comes out and I leave with a bad exhaust repair. I don't care how stubborn or belligerent a customer is being, you don't threaten or insult them. I would not recommend this place to anyone.
